Roofing repairs vary depending on the extent of the damage and the materials involved. If your leak is isolated to a few shingles, the fix is usually straightforward. However, if the underlying decking is rotted or the flashing around your chimney is compromised, the labor and material needs increase. Steep roof pitches can also add to the cost due to safety requirements. We assess your unique situation to give you a clear picture of what is needed. Exact pricing confirmed free on the call.
A tin roof is a classic metal roofing style known for its longevity and distinct appearance. These roofs are highly durable, but they can be prone to rust if the protective coating wears down over time. You should consider repairs or restoration if you spot signs of corrosion or loose fasteners that could allow moisture inside. A galvanized steel roof in Los Angeles is coated with zinc to prevent rust. Other metal roofing options might use aluminum, copper, or steel alloys with different coatings, each offering distinct durability and aesthetic profiles.
